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Desert Hare. | Lemming Mountain Vole |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Mammals)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Lagomorpha (Rabbits & Hares)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Leporidae (Rabbits & Hares) | Cricetidae |
| Genus | Lepus | Alticola |
| Species | Lepus tibetanus | Alticola lemminus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Desert Hare. and Lemming Mountain Vole share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
